The Dehumanizers began as a bet between two brothers in 1984. David Ulysses Portnow bet his older brother, Infra Ed, that he could have far greater success playing the punk music that he loved, as opposed to his then current work as a union musician playing covers at parties, company functions, and bar mitzvahs. David came up with the name and had a band logo created. Because of David's marketing skills, the band started receiving international orders for a non-existent demo tape entitled "Save The World.
